Design of the Evaluation of the Effective Practice Incentive Community Initiative

Scott Cody, Alison Wellington and Duncan Chaplin

Mathematica Policy Research Reports from Mathematica Policy Research

Abstract: This report details our estimation procedures, documents what is currently known about how EPIC operates within the various partners, and provides a work plan for the evaluation.
